Delicious and Easy Vegan Mango Mousse

This vegan mango mousse features pureed mango blended with coconut cream for a rich, velvety texture. It takes about 15 minutes to prepare and chills in the refrigerator for a couple of hours before serving, making it an excellent choice for entertaining or a personal treat.
Ingredients
- 2 ripe mangoes, peeled and diced
- 1 can (13.5 oz) full-fat coconut cream, refrigerated overnight
- 1/4 cup maple syrup or agave nectar (adjust to taste)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
- Fresh mint leaves for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- Prepare the Mango: In a blender, add the diced mangoes and blend until smooth, scraping down the sides as necessary.
- Whip the Coconut Cream: Open the refrigerated can of coconut cream and scoop out the solidified cream into a mixing bowl. Whip it with a hand mixer until light and fluffy.
- Combine Ingredients: Gradually fold the mango puree into the whipped coconut cream. Add in the maple syrup,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t, mixing gently until well combined.
- Chill the Mousse: Divide the mixture into serving glasses or bowls and refrigerate for at least 2 hours to allow it to set.
- Serve: Once chilled, garnish with fresh mint leaves if desired and enjoy your tropical mango mousse.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Chill Time: 2 hours
- Total Time: 2 hours 15 minutes
Nutrition Information
- Servings: 4 servings
- Calories: 210kcal
- Fat: 12g
- Protein: 1g
- Carbohydrates: 29g
